Output 9ab58f3910dd798d9be6d8046696212853841898ff547ee85ab8b79f5eafeaa8:0

value
22680800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f61c7e496add89a7d23b96891e35754c3d7901c OP_EQUAL
address
3Em9guYiuQvYHE2nsKUnP8HtAt7D9igDWa
transaction
9ab58f3910dd798d9be6d8046696212853841898ff547ee85ab8b79f5eafeaa8
confirmations
433424
spent
true